**Meeting notes — Gatewell proctoring queue, sprint review.** We walked new joiners through how exam sessions enter the review queue: flagged events are scored by the Sentry model, then routed to human proctors by priority. Queue depth alarms fire above 300 pending sessions. Backlog drills happen Fridays. The queue's accountable owner is recorded below.

approver of yajef-fajef = Oliwyn Silion Kasok Kasox

**Ticket SEC-1177: crash-report ingest key expired**

The Splinterfall mobile crash-report pipeline lost ingest auth on Friday; the Crashloom collector key had expired silently. Reports queued client-side, no data loss confirmed. Rotation performed, old key revoked, scope unchanged (write-only to crash topic). Flagging for security review per policy since the lapse exceeded 24 hours. The newly issued key is recorded below.

API key for tagef-fafop: vxb2-ta

Action Item 4: Begin phased refactor of the Quillbase legacy ORM layer. The incident traced back to implicit lazy-loading in Quillbase issuing N+1 queries under load, saturating the primary database. We will wrap all hot-path queries in explicit fetch plans first, then migrate modules to the new data-access interface one bounded context at a time, with query-count regression tests gating each step. Owner: Senna, data platform. The migration plan and module checklist are on the internal page below.

runbook for badug-kadup: https://confluence.zemvarlabs.internal/projects/browse/display/projects/bd1b

Release checklist — Sketchloom diagram editor. Verify undo/redo before sign-off: draw three shapes, group them, delete the group, then undo twice and redo once. History should survive a tab refresh now (new this release), so tell customers they won't lose steps mid-session. If redo greys out unexpectedly, that's the old bug resurfacing — escalate rather than workaround. For reports, ask customers to quote the build shown below.

session token of tajef-bageg = htk21_5d90d574934f3ccae6437

Changed defaults in Splitfork, our assignment service. Bucketing now uses sticky hashing per account instead of per session, and the holdout slice grew from 2% to 5%. Callers relying on session-level reassignment must opt in explicitly. Review the diff against the new baseline; the updated default configuration is listed below.

config for tagep-kajof:
[casir]
port = 6379
region = south-1
host = casir.paliqdyn.example
team = tamax
timeout_ms = 250
retries = 2